Output 3a1086fc24560c24529dfd2d300a7902129ac9402cff07872956ea9b3a0dfc17:1

value
28960416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ea5785817e7a1b1a83dcce8c4dffa68b5e38c075 OP_EQUAL
address
3P46tXsGCSskGV38KW7Y6bX2tXv3ysDz4H
transaction
3a1086fc24560c24529dfd2d300a7902129ac9402cff07872956ea9b3a0dfc17
spent
true